How Attic Water Damage Restoration Actually Works
When you call us for attic water damage restoration, you can expect a thorough and meticulous process that prioritizes your safety and property’s integrity. Our team will arrive promptly, assess the damage, and develop a customized plan to restore your attic to its original condition.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our technicians will inspect your attic, identifying the source of the water intrusion and assessing the extent of the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ture and pinpoint areas of concern.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your attic, preventing further damage and mold growth. Our team will also extract water from walls, ceilings, and floors to ensure a thorough dry-out.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ll employ advanced drying techniques, including dehumidification and air circulation, to remove excess moisture from your attic. This prevents mold growth and ensures a safe environment for your family.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ll use eco-friendly sanitizing agents to eliminate hazardous materials and debris from your attic, ensuring a healthy environment for your family.
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ction
Our team will repair or replace damaged materials, including drywall, insulation, and roofing, to restore your attic to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Damage Restoration
Catching these warning sign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ore the signs – call us today to schedule an inspection.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ors in your attic or home can indicate mold growth or water damage. Don’t ignore the smell – it’s a sign of a bigger problem.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Discoloration or water stains on your ceiling or walls can indicate a leak or water intrusion in your attic. Address the issue promptly to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or structural issues in your attic. Don’t delay – call us to inspect and repair the damage.
Increased Energy Bills
Unexpected spikes in your energy bills can indicate poor insulation or air leaks in your attic. Our team can help you identify and repair the issue.

Attic Water Damage Restoration Cost in Little Havana, FL
The cost of attic water damage restoration var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Little Havana, FL.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water removed.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the moisture damage and the type of equipment needed. |
| Sanitizing and dis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of hazardous materials present. |
| Repair and re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air. |
| Inspection and assessment |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the inspection and the expertise required. |
| Permitting and inspections | $500 – $2,000 | The type of permit required and the frequency of inspections. |

Q: How can I prevent attic water damage?
A: Regular inspections, proper ventilation, and maintaining a clean and dry attic space can help prevent water damage. Our team can provide guidance on how to maintain your attic and prevent future issues.
Q: What equipment do you use for attic water damage restoration?
A: Our team uses advanced equipment, including industrial-grade pumps, vacuums, and dehumidifiers, to remove water, dry out the space, and prevent mold growth.
